Versatility and flexibility make the Marantz SR8001 home cinema receiver the ideal installation (22/11/2006)

SR8001 - THX Select II certified, 7.1 home cinema receiver with two HDMI outputs £1,199.90

Designed with high-level custom installations in mind the Marantz SR8001 home cinema receiver not only delivers HDMI quality performance from a range of sources, but it can carry this out in to two separate locations, giving independent audio or video source selection and control in a second room as well as audio only in a third room.

Such versatility and flexibility comes via four HDMI inputs and two outputs delivering full bandwidth, uncompressed digital video signal transmission to two separate displays. There's also video and audio switching, upconversion from analogue video signals to HDMI including interlaced to progressive conversion.

The SR8001 also features multi room/multi source functionality, speaker A/B switching, two assignable DC triggers, two flasher inputs, a RS232c communication port, and an extensive array of both analog and digital connections. These include seven assignable digital inputs, four component inputs, and a multi room speaker and OSD output. With all this on board the SR8001 takes versatility to a new level.

As well as being THX Select II certified the SR8001 incorporates the most advanced 32-bit Digital Signal Processing circuitry, which decodes the latest generation of digital surround sound such as THX Surround EX, Dolby Digital EX, DTS ES, DTS Neo:6, Circle Surround II, and Dolby Pro-Logic IIx. This provides uncompromised six, seven or eight channel playback of any multi-channel format, whether it's movie soundtracks or music, over the widest seating area.

But there's more to the SR8001 than mere technical trickery. It is, at its core, an exceptionally impressive amplifier and a clear example of benchmark engineering.

At its heart is a massive toroidal transformer allied to customized oversized filter capacitors, capable of delivering a conservatively estimated 900 Watts from its seven amplifiers for authoritative, effortless reproduction of movie soundtracks and music. The SR8001 features a range of proprietary Marantz sound enhancements such as an all Discrete Current Feedback amplifier circuit topology which makes the design insensitive to difficult loudspeaker loads. You'll also find high-grade components and audiophile-grade 24-bit/192kHz DACs on all channels.

All of the digital, analogue and control circuits are separated and extensively shielded in their own enclosures to prevent cross-talk and other unwanted interference. Independent power supplies for the FL display, audio and video sections secure maximum separation, clarity and dynamics. The SR8001 employs an ultra rigid, extensively braced and shielded chassis, to give the electronics the perfect foundation. Marantz has even designed a new intelligent cooling system and high efficiency heatsink.

And despite the deluge of technology the SR8001 is actually a doddle to use thanks to its intuitive operation and elegant backlit learning remote handset. Set-up couldn't be easier, either, with the SR8001 delivering the best sound for your room automatically, thanks to the Room Acoustic Calibration function with MultEQ by Audyssey.

This system - developed by a handful of audio experts at the University of Southern California including THX inventor Tom Holman - automatically determines how many loudspeakers are connected to the SR8001, whether they are connected in phase and whether they are satellites or subwoofers. When it has processed this the system then calibrates speaker level, size, and distance. The measurement for the optimum set-up will be done automatically on up to six listening positions to correct any room influence. The correction is applied by an equalizer in the frequency domain as well as in the time domain. The system compensates for more than one listening location at the same time, giving nearly every listener in the room a 'sweet spot' no matter where they're sitting. A dedicated high sensitive audio microphone is supplied.
